German wholesalers set for revenue increase in 2019, 2020

German wholesalers will likely see a 2.3 percent increase in nominal revenue this year to 1.3 billion euros ($1.43 billion), the BGA trade association said on Monday, adding that firms in the sector nonetheless planned to cut investments, Trend with reference to Reuters reports.

BGA forecast an increase of up to 2 percent in nominal revenue for next year.
